Sardinia, Italy
  • Resident population: 1,655,677 Annual visitors: 12,000,000 (est.)
  • Major features: beaches, caves and grottoes, forest scenery
  • 13,226 TripAdvisor reviews of 1,395 accommodations, 81 attractions and 281 restaurants
The second-largest island in Mediterranean after Sicily, Sardinia serves up a lovely blend of sea, sand and history. Thousands of nuraghe (stone buildings) dot the landscape, proof that people have been enjoying the lovely climate here for millennia.

Santorini, Greece
  • Resident population: 13,725 Annual visitors: 1,500,000 (est.)
  • Major features: beaches, architecture, archaeological sites
  • 14,989 TripAdvisor reviews of 664 accommodations, 24 attractions and 117 restaurants
Glamorous Santorini, in the southern Aegean's Cyclades islands, curves round a giant lagoon, a caldera left by a volcanic eruption.
